1 definition by MORRO "MR ROAST" MORRISON

to put a on a roast involves:
>two eager males
>one horney slut wanting some cock
>and a shinny dollar (decides who goes where)

the ladie must then let the males enter her baby cave and cake hole
AT THE SAME TIME..... she will love it!

try it next dinner party you'll be surprised

also see spit roast
>>"come on boys lets chuck her on the roast"
>"is your sister home cause im hungry for a roast"
>>"roast her"
by MORRO "MR ROAST" MORRISON October 20, 2006
99 108